This friendly place is said to be Stockholm’s longest-running café. Its heyday was in the 30s and 40s, but unfortunately few of the café’s original features are left.

Those that do remain are drowned out by modern Coca-Cola ads, pop music and a TV screen showing non-stop commercials.

However, the coffee at Café Fix isn’t bad and there are some lovely homemade muffins to sink your teeth into.

Also on offer are big, fresh sandwiches stuffed with ingredients like mozzarella and salami, and Mexican lunches like nachos and burritos.

Healthy breakfasts are also sold here and even if you eat quite a lot, you’ll struggle to spend more than about 120 SEK per person.

Unfortunately there’s a real shortage of great places to eat in this part of Kungsholmen, but if you get hungry while you’re exploring then this is a reasonable option to fall back on.
